I use MapSource Topo on my 76S. It is OK if you load the maps for the area
you will be visiting. Depending on the Garmin you have, there is a
restriction on how many Topos you can load. My 76S holds about 23 meg of
maps.. I also use road and recreation maps from Garmin. So the topos are
close to home and the roads and rec maps are installed for my trip. If you
are doing a lot of drive up caches, roads helps a lot. Topo maps sometimes
gets confusing because of the contour lines. IE: Not sure if that is the
creek or a contour line.
I use GSAK and MapPoint. However, Streets and Trips is probably more user
friendly and certainly costs a lot less..
